Beschreibung des Verlags

This book compiles selected works from a workshop promoting collaboration between academia, industry, and society by engaging educators, researchers, technicians, and students. It highlights advancements in Artificial Intelligence, Additive Fabrication, Smart Manufacturing, and 3D Printing. Key topics include circular economy, bio-inspired sensory fusion systems, computer-aided design, and machine vision in manufacturing. Themes also explore industrial robotics, neuromorphic systems, product design, efficiency management, and automatic control in manufacturing. By integrating STEM, industrial and environmental chemistry, and sustainable technologies, this book underscores innovative approaches for future industrial and societal challenges.
